Gene Wolfe is a fine writer.  You probably read The
Book of the New Sun, which is his best work.  Imagine
Kipling, Kafka, Borges & Nabokov writing a science
fantasy (don't the words just make you cringe?  Bear
with me here...) while undergoing a conversion to
Catholicism, and you'll get the gist of it.  Not that
he's their equal, but you'll see what he seems to be
aiming for.  It's currently published in 2 volumes,
Shadow & Claw and Sword & Citadel.
